WebCeladon City is located in central Kanto and is a home to Erika, the city's Gym Leader. The city has two entrances, one from the east via Route 7, and one from the west via Route 16. Celadon is the main place to spend money in Kanto, through the Celadon Department Store and the Celadon Game Corner. WebFeb 15, 2024 · The Rocket Hideout is one giant maze full of Team Rocket Grunts looking to prevent you from reaching their Boss on the bottom level. In order to reach the Team Rocket Boss, you will need to use the elevator lift. In order to use it, however, you will need to find the Lift Key. Celadon Gym is run by the Grass-type specialist, Erika, and isn't too tough compared to what you've faced so far. Two of her three Pokémon can inflict status conditions, so packing curatives for sleep, poison and paralysis is recommended.
